https://github.com/rwl/lufact_rs
Sparse LU factorization with partial pivoting in Rust
https://github.com/rwl/lufact_rs
gilbert-peierls lu-decomposition sparse-linear-solver sparse-linear-systems
Last synced: 2 months ago
JSON representation
Sparse LU factorization with partial pivoting in Rust
- Host: GitHub
- URL: https://github.com/rwl/lufact_rs
- Owner: rwl
- License: apache-2.0
- Created: 2023-08-13T10:29:42.000Z (almost 2 years ago)
- Default Branch: main
- Last Pushed: 2023-09-08T15:46:36.000Z (almost 2 years ago)
- Last Synced: 2025-03-28T22:15:27.184Z (3 months ago)
- Topics: gilbert-peierls, lu-decomposition, sparse-linear-solver, sparse-linear-systems
- Language: Rust
- Homepage: https://crates.io/crates/lufact
- Size: 162 KB
- Stars: 1
- Watchers: 2
- Forks: 0
- Open Issues: 0
-
Metadata Files:
- Readme: README.md
- License: LICENSE-APACHE
Awesome Lists containing this project
README
# lufact
Sparse LU factorization with partial pivoting as described in
"Sparse Partial Pivoting in Time Proportional to Arithmetic
Operations" by John R. Gilbert and Tim Peierls.```bibtex
@article{Gilbert1988,
doi = {10.1137/0909058},
url = {https://doi.org/10.1137/0909058},
year = {1988},
month = {sep},
publisher = {Society for Industrial {\&} Applied Mathematics ({SIAM})},
volume = {9},
number = {5},
pages = {862--874},
author = {John R. Gilbert and Tim Peierls},
title = {Sparse Partial Pivoting in Time Proportional to Arithmetic Operations},
journal = {{SIAM} Journal on Scientific and Statistical Computing}
}
```The original FORTRAN source is distributed in Sivan Toledo's work on
incomplete-factorization, from PARC in the early 1990s, and can be
found in the [ILU](http://www.netlib.org/linalg/ilu.tgz) package on Netlib.## License
Licensed, with permission from John Gilbert and Tim Peierls, under either the
* Apache License, Version 2.0 ([LICENSE-APACHE](LICENSE-APACHE) or https://www.apache.org/licenses/LICENSE-2.0) or
* MIT license ([LICENSE-MIT](LICENSE-MIT) or https://opensource.org/licenses/MIT)at your option.